Destination Overview

Morocco, in Arabic "Al Maghreb" meaning the setting sun, is the furthest land west of the Arab world. Located in the North of Africa, Morocco is at the junction of the Mediterranean Sea and the Atlantic Ocean. With evidence of presence of Homo erectus (at least 200,000 years ago) Morocco's history has been rich and tumultuous. The Berbers, descendents of the original inhabitants, where fierce warriors and where notoriously difficult to subdue. Invasions from the Phoenicians, Romans, Vandals, Byzantines and Arabs have contributed to the variety of today's Morocco.
